Michelle's intention as an osteopathic practitioner is to promote health, and genuine self expression while addressing specific pain and injuries in those she has the privilege to treat. While treating the body as a functional whole, the following manual therapy techniques are often utilized; biodynamic osteopathy, myofascial release, cranial osteopathy, visceral manipulation, scar tissue mobilization, muscle energy techniques, functional, indirect and direct structural mobilization, and soft tissue release.
Osteopathic treatment is recommended for all ages including newborns. In the treatment of children, osteopathy is a highly effective preventative health measure.
